Harris Company manufactures a single product. Costs for the year 2015 for output levels of 1,000 and 2,000 units are given in the table. At each level compute the following:
A. Total manufacturing costs
B. Manufacturing costs per unit
C.Total Variable cost
D. Total variable cost per unit
E. Total costs that have to be recovered if the firm makes a profit
Table:
Unit Produced | 1000 | 2000 | |
Direct labour | $30,000 | $60,000 | |
Direct Materials | $20,000 | $40,000 | |
Overhead: | |||
Variable portion | $12,000 | $24,000 | |
Fixed portion | $36,000 | $36,000 | |
Selling and Administrative cost | |||
Variable portion | $5,000 | $10,000 | |
Fixed portion | $22,000 | $22,000 |
If possible please show all work
